Install systems and equipment for fire protection

Fires are among the incidents that companies must be as prepared for as possible. It is important for companies to have a certain number of systems and equipment capable of ensuring optimal risk management and enhanced security.

Fire detection system

Fire detection plays a crucial role within an infrastructure, as this system allows for the detection of any potential fire that may occur at any time of day or night. Companies can then minimize risks by installing this system.

Fire protection system

Detection means protection! The fire protection system, on the other hand, acts directly on the fire itself. This means that this system allows companies to protect individuals, interiors, and materials from any fire outbreak.

Associated equipment

Directly linked to fire detection and protection systems, equipment such as sprinklers, fire alarms, PPMS, rechargeable extinguishers, as well as fire doors and fire blankets.

Sounding your infrastructures

Public address system

In the event of an incident, companies must notify individuals in the buildings, factories, or any other concerned infrastructure as quickly as possible. This can notably be done by installing a complete public address system equipped with the necessary devices.

Associated equipment

To broadcast announcements or convey any kind of message in the event of an incident, companies must equip themselves with microphones, speakers, and any other effective equipment.

Connecting systems and equipment to a UAE

The UAE (Unit of Assistance for Operations) is a technology that enables effective and rapid fire management. Concretely, the UAE is a central unit that allows systems, equipment, and alarms to be centralized within a single interface. Thus, companies can:


- Visualize in real-time all their systems and equipment on the infrastructure map.

- Visualize the floor concerned by the fire with just a few clicks.

- Relay the alarm directly to locate the fire


Strategically installing alarms

Alarms are among the essential equipment needed in any infrastructure. Therefore, companies must equip and strategically install alarms to quickly verify and manage the incident as efficiently as possible. To do this, it is important to:


- Install alarms near systems and equipment.

- Install alarms in high-risk areas (areas prone to theft, intrusion...)


Training security personnel in incident management

With the installation of all these systems, equipment, and technologies, companies must be able to impart skills to their security personnel, such as operators. For this, company security managers can organize practical training sessions so that any operator at their post can handle an incident as quickly and efficiently as possible.
